Request evaluation
This settable value prevents entire plants from being switched on (e.g. refrigeration
plants) in the case of extremely low refrigeration requests. Switching on (i.e. routing
as a bus signal or to outputs Q, d, Y, a) takes place only when the set value "Limit
value request on" is exceeded.
On
Use setting value "Flow temperature increase max" to enable optimization, which
determines the current optimum flow temperature for control from the received
request signals.
In this case, value "Flow temperature increase max" can be floating, i.e. deviate
from the set value for "Chilled water flow setpoint".
This current flow temperature is controlled to a 90% valve position of the
refrigeration consumer with the greatest demand (evaluation of request in setting
"Maximum") so that:
 Valve position < 90 %: The flow temperature is increased continuously until
value "Chilled water flow setpoint" plus "Flow temperature increase max" is
reached.
 Valve position > 90 %: The flow temperature is decreased continuously until
value "Chilled water flow setpoint" is reached.
As a result, the following max. flow temperature setpoint can be set at valve
positions ≤ 90%:
This optimization function is enabled only if value "Flow temperature increase
max" > 0 (factory setting: 0 = disabled).
The "Control action" of the flow temperature on the setpoint shifts can be set in
three steps ("Fast", "Medium", "Slow") to adapt to the plant.
